What does DP-1 mean in insurance?
A DP1 policy, also called Dwelling Fire Form 1, is a type of home insurance policy that protects a house from nine named perils – most notably fire. It's usually used to insure vacant homes but can also be used for rental properties if landlords are on a tight budget.

What is the difference between DP1 and DP3 insurance?
DP1 offers basic, cost-effective coverage suitable for vacant or lower-value homes. In contrast, DP3 insurance provides comprehensive protection ideal for landlords and property owners. DP3 policy coverage generally offers more perils covered, superior structure protection, and customizable coverage options.
Is cash covered under DP1?
A DP1 only protects your dwelling for its actual cash value. With a DP3, the structure of your home is usually covered for its replacement value, or what it would cost to rebuild your home from the ground up with similar materials after a total loss.

What does a DP1 policy cover?
A DP-1 policy covers nine specific perils: fire and lightning, windstorms, explosions, hail, riots or civil commotions, smoke, aircraft-related damage, vehicle-related damage, and volcanic eruption.
What is the difference between DP-1 and DP 3?
Unlike the named peril DP1 which only covers listed events, a DP3 policy covers all risks except those specifically excluded in the policy documents. This open peril approach means your rental property is protected against a wide range of perils like water damage, theft, falling objects, ice and snow, and more.
